Hush started life in 2003 as a loungewear brand created by the enterprising Mandy Watkins. Missing the balmy evenings of her native Australian and learning to embrace chilly British nights curled in front of the fire, Watkins spotted a niche in the market for comfy yet stylish lounging wear. She’s since evolved the brand to include elegant dresses, cashmere jumpers, key denim pieces, and handpicked accessories and – now – beach wear.
